> From memory, you have to lie and tell it that it has a little less > memory than it really has (about 2 or 3 MB less). I also have a vague > recollection that if you use a 2.4 kernel it will figure out how much > memory is there and use it all. Thanks - I set it to 127mb and that seems to have fixed it (though when I modified lilo.conf, I upset the apm settings..) I've not seen a clear explanation of how to use multiple 'append' commands in lilo.conf. Eventually I put it in as below: append="apm=on mem=127m" That seems to have worked..
